Gary VanLandingham serves as the Reubin O'D. Askew Senior Practitioner in Residence at Florida State University's College of Social Sciences and Public Policy, where he leverages over 30 years of leadership experience in public and nonprofit sectors to advance evidence-based governance. A nationally recognized expert, he focuses on translating rigorous evidence into practical policy solutions for state and local governments.
His academic credentials include:
- Ph.D. in Public Policy and Administration, Florida State University (2006)
- MPA in Public Administration, Florida State University (1980)
- BA with High Honors in Political Science, University of Florida (1979)
Dr. VanLandingham's research pioneers evidence-informed approaches to public administration, examining how governments can systematically integrate evaluation data into decision-making processes. His work bridges academic theory and practical implementation, with particular emphasis on performance management systems and overcoming barriers between researchers and policymakers. He actively contributes to evolving frameworks for evidence-based governance in complex political environments.
His recent publications (2016-2020) reveal a critical trajectory in evidence-based policy scholarship, moving from foundational case studies of evidence-policy interfaces toward holistic governance models. Key thematic developments include standardizing evaluation methodologies, addressing political constraints in evidence utilization, and designing institutional mechanisms for sustained evidence integration across government agencies.
Notable honors recognize his exceptional contributions:
- Fellow, National Academy of Public Administration (2023)
- Specialized Faculty Teaching Award, FSU College of Social Sciences and Public Policy (2020)
- Outstanding Lifetime Achievement Award, National Legislative Program Evaluation Society (2018)
- Harry Hatry Distinguished Performance Management Practice Award (2016)
- Leadership Achievement Award, ASPA North Florida Chapter (2008)
